The SMC air-operated valve combines innovative engineering with reliable functionality, making it an essential component for fluid control systems. Designed for versatility, this valve features a unique universal porting mechanism, allowing for easy adaptations to various piping configurations. Its robust construction ensures outstanding performance, even in challenging environments, with an operating pressure range suitable for a multitude of applications. The valve operates in both normally closed and normally open configurations, making it adaptable to specific operational requirements. With a sturdy return mechanism powered by air and spring, this valve guarantees quick and efficient operation. The VGA342 not only simplifies installation but also enhances system efficiency, delivering exceptional reliability and effectiveness in fluid management tasks.

Utilises a universal porting design for increased flexibility
Robust air and spring return mechanism ensures reliable operation
Designed to handle a diverse range of operating pressures
Allows for easy switching between normally closed and normally open settings
Exceptional impact and vibration resistance enhances durability in demanding conditions
Compact dimensions facilitate seamless integration into existing systems
Lightweight yet sturdy construction reduces installation complexity
Eliminates the need for lubrication under standard operating conditions
Environmental compatibility ensures performance in temperatures as low as -10°C
